Abstract
The ability to rapidly acquire synchronized phasor measurements from around the system open up new possibilities for power system operation and control. A novel neuro-fuzzy network, Fuzzy Hyperrectangular Composite Neural Network, is proposed for voltage security monitoring (VSM) using synchronized phasor measurements as input patterns. This paper demonstrates how neuro-fuzzy networks can be constructed off-line and then utilized on-line for monitoring voltage security. The neuro-fuzzy network is tested on 3000 simulated datas from randomly generated operating conditions on the IEEE 30bus system to indicate its high classification rate for voltage security monitoring. © 1997 IEEE.
